Picking the Right Paint Colors



When picking paint shades for achieving a distressed look in your home, it is vital to take into consideration tones that complement the vintage aesthetic you aim to create. To accomplish a troubled paint appearance, go with colors generally connected with aged or weathered coatings.



Neutral tones like soft whites, luscious off-whites, muted grays, and earthy browns work well to produce a feeling of background and antiquity. These shades supply a refined backdrop for the distressed result to shine through, offering your space a timeworn charm.

For a much more rustic or farmhouse feel, think about incorporating much deeper shades such as navy blues, woodland greens, or rich burgundies. These darker colors can add depth and heat to your troubled finish, stimulating a comfy and welcoming environment evocative quaint beauty.

Furthermore, pastel tones like soft blues, blush pinks, or light yellows can bring a delicate touch to your distressed look, excellent for developing a shoddy elegant or cottage-inspired atmosphere. Remember, the secret is to pick shades that improve the vintage vibe you want to achieve in your house.

Prepping Your Surfaces



Effectively preparing your surfaces is important to attaining a flawless distressed paint look in your home. The initial step in prepping your surfaces is to guarantee they are tidy and free of any type of dirt, oil, or old paint. Utilize a mild detergent or a degreaser to completely clean the surfaces and allow them to completely dry totally before proceeding.

After cleaning, inspect the surfaces for any kind of blemishes such as splits, openings, or irregular locations. Complete any type of fractures or openings with spackling substance and sand down any kind of rough spots to produce a smooth base for the paint.

Next, it is vital to prime your surface areas before using the troubled paint. Guide assists the paint stick better to the surface and supplies an uniform base for the paint shade. Select a primer that appropriates for the surface you are servicing, whether it's wood, metal, or drywall.

Last but not least, think about fining sand the surfaces lightly to produce a somewhat harsh structure that will certainly improve the troubled look of the paint. Sand along the sides and edges where all-natural damage would strike mimic an aged appearance.

Complying with these steps will certainly ensure that your surfaces are effectively prepped for attaining a gorgeous distressed paint finish in your house.

Distressing Techniques & Tips



To accomplish an authentic distressed paint search in your home, understanding numerous upsetting methods and incorporating useful ideas is important.

One effective strategy is dry brushing, which includes applying a percentage of paint to a dry brush and gently sweeping it over the surface to develop a weathered effect.

One more prominent technique is fining sand, where sandpaper is made use of to carefully eliminate layers of paint, revealing the underlying shades and adding a used look.

For a much more rustic look, think about using a snap medium in between coats of paint to accomplish a broken finish similar to aged paint.

In addition to these strategies, there are some key ideas to bear in mind when upsetting paint.

Beginning with a skim coat in a contrasting shade to make sure that it glances via when traumatic.

Try out different tools such as sandpaper, steel wool, or even a damp cloth to accomplish varying levels of distress.

Remember to focus on high-traffic locations and edges where all-natural damage would certainly take place.

Finally, practice on a little example board prior to using upsetting methods to your entire surface to perfect your wanted appearance.
